Key Insights
The global Automotive Motor Oil market is a significant and relatively stable industry, projected to reach USD 3.12 billion in 2024. While exhibiting a modest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 0.95% during the forecast period of 2025-2033, this indicates a mature market with steady demand. The primary drivers for this sustained growth are the vast existing vehicle parc, particularly in developing regions, and the essential need for regular maintenance to ensure engine longevity and optimal performance. Despite the increasing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s), the sheer volume of internal combustion engine (ICE) vehicles worldwide continues to underpin the demand for motor oil. Technological advancements in lubricant formulations, focusing on improved fuel efficiency, extended drain intervals, and enhanced engine protection against wear and tear, are also key factors supporting market value.

However, the market faces notable restraints that temper its growth potential. The accelerating shift towards electric mobility represents a significant long-term challenge, as EVs do not require traditional motor oil. Stringent environmental regulations and the growing awareness of sustainability are also pushing for the development and adoption of greener lubricant alternatives and influencing consumer choices. Furthermore, economic downturns and fluctuating raw material prices, particularly for base oils and additives, can impact profitability and market dynamics. The competitive landscape is dominated by well-established global players, leading to price sensitivity and intense competition, especially in mature markets. The market is segmented across various vehicle types, including Commercial Vehicles, Motorcycles, and Passenger Vehicles, with distinct product grades catering to specific engine requirements and performance expectations.

Key Drivers of Automotive Motor Oil Industry Growth
The Automotive Motor Oil industry's growth is propelled by a confluence of factors. The expanding global vehicle parc, particularly in emerging economies, directly fuels demand for lubricants. Technological advancements in engine design, such as downsizing and turbocharging, necessitate the use of higher-performance synthetic and semi-synthetic oils. Furthermore, stringent environmental regulations mandating improved fuel efficiency and reduced emissions are driving the adoption of advanced lubricant formulations. Government policies supporting the automotive manufacturing sector also contribute significantly to market expansion. The increasing disposable income in developing nations is also a key driver, enabling greater vehicle ownership and subsequent lubricant consumption.
Challenges in the Automotive Motor Oil Industry Sector
Despite robust growth, the Automotive Motor Oil sector faces several challenges. The increasing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) presents a long-term threat, as EVs require different types of specialized fluids and significantly less traditional motor oil. Fluctuating raw material prices, particularly for base oils and additives, can impact profit margins and pricing strategies. Stringent environmental regulations, while driving innovation, also impose compliance costs on manufacturers. Intense competition among major players and the presence of numerous smaller, regional brands can lead to price wars and pressure on profitability, with estimated profit margin erosion of up to XX% in competitive segments.

Key Developments in Automotive Motor Oil Industry Industry
- January 2022: Effective April 1, ExxonMobil Corporation was organized along three business lines - ExxonMobil Upstream Company, ExxonMobil Product Solutions and ExxonMobil Low Carbon Solutions. This strategic restructuring is anticipated to enhance operational efficiency and focus on diversified business segments.
- December 2021: ExxonMobil introduced a line of synthetic engine oils, i.e., Mobil Super Pro, for SUVs in India. This launch caters to the growing demand for high-performance lubricants in the rapidly expanding SUV market in India, valued at over $XX billion.
- October 2021: Castrol, one of Malaysia's major automotive lubricant manufacturers, introduced Castrol Power1 Ultimate, a brand-new type of 100% synthetic engine oil that promises exceptional performance and endurance.
